To delete one or more domains:
1. In the List of Domains table, select the check box to the left of the domain that you want to
delete, or click the Select All table button to select all domains. You cannot delete a default
domain.
2. Click the Delete table button.
Configuring Groups for VPN Policies
The use of groups simplifies the configuration of VPN policies when different sets of users have
different restrictions and access controls. Like the default domain of the VPN firewall, the default
group is also named geardomain. The default group geardomain is assigned to the default domain
geardomain. You cannot delete the default domain geardomain, nor its associated default group
geardomain.
When you create a new domain, a default group with the same name as the new domain is created
automatically. You cannot delete this default group either. However, when you delete the domain
with which it is associated, the default group is deleted automatically.
Creating and Deleting Groups
To create a VPN group:
1. Select Users > Groups from the menu. The Groups screen displays. Figure 7-3 on page 7-7
shows the VPN firewall’s default group—geardomain—and, as an example, several other
groups in the List of Groups table.
Note: IPsec VPN users always belong to the default domain (geardomain) and are not
assigned to groups.
Note: Groups that are defined on the User screen are used for setting SSL VPN policies.
These groups should not be confused with LAN groups that are defined on the
LAN Groups screen and that are used to simplify firewall policies. For information
about LAN groups, see “Managing Groups and Hosts (LAN Groups)” on
page 3-14.
